Source code for nlp_shap.viz.token_text

"""SHAP-style inline colored token attribution renderer."""

from collections.abc import Sequence
from typing import TYPE_CHECKING, Any, cast

from ..domain.estimands import Estimand
from .colors import token_background_css, token_background_rgba
from .style import new_attribution_figure, polish_text_axes

if TYPE_CHECKING:
    from matplotlib.figure import Figure


[docs] class TokenTextRenderer: """Render attributions as inline colored tokens.""" @property def name(self) -> str: """Return the registered renderer identifier.""" return "token_text"
[docs] def render( self, labels: Sequence[str], values: Sequence[float], *, estimand: Estimand, title: str | None = None, ) -> "Figure": """Build a matplotlib figure with SHAP-style colored token labels.""" if len(labels) != len(values): msg = "labels and values must have the same length" raise ValueError(msg) if not labels: msg = "cannot render an empty attribution" raise ValueError(msg) vmax = max(abs(value) for value in values) header = title or f"{estimand.value.title()} token attributions" width = max(7.5, min(14.0, 1.1 + sum(len(label) for label in labels) * 0.11)) fig, axis = new_attribution_figure(width=width, height=2.4) polish_text_axes(axis) axis.set_title( header, loc="left", fontsize=13, fontweight="semibold", color="#111827", pad=12, ) cursor_x = 0.02 baseline_y = 0.42 for label, value in zip(labels, values, strict=True): red, green, blue, alpha = token_background_rgba(value, vmax) token_width = max(0.06, len(label) * 0.013) axis.text( cursor_x, baseline_y, label, transform=axis.transAxes, fontsize=12, va="center", ha="left", color="#111827", bbox={ "boxstyle": "round,pad=0.35,rounding_size=0.08", "facecolor": (red, green, blue, alpha), "edgecolor": "none", }, ) cursor_x += token_width _draw_color_legend(axis) fig.tight_layout() return cast("Figure", fig)
[docs] def to_html( self, labels: Sequence[str], values: Sequence[float], *, estimand: Estimand, title: str | None = None, ) -> str: """Return an HTML fragment with colored token spans for Jupyter.""" if len(labels) != len(values): msg = "labels and values must have the same length" raise ValueError(msg) vmax = max(abs(value) for value in values) header = title or f"{estimand.value.title()} token attributions" spans: list[str] = [] for label, value in zip(labels, values, strict=True): background = token_background_css(value, vmax) value_label = f"{value:+.3f}" spans.append( '<span class="nlp-shap-token" ' f'title="{estimand.value}: {value_label}" ' f'style="background-color:{background};">' f"{_escape_html(label)}</span>" ) body = "".join(spans) return ( '<div class="nlp-shap-attribution" ' 'style="font-family:system-ui,-apple-system,Segoe UI,Roboto,' 'Helvetica Neue,Arial,sans-serif;line-height:1.8;color:#111827;">' f'<div style="font-size:14px;font-weight:600;margin-bottom:8px;">' f"{_escape_html(header)}</div>" '<div style="font-size:12px;color:#6B7280;margin-bottom:10px;">' '<span style="display:inline-block;width:10px;height:10px;' 'border-radius:2px;background:#FF0D57;margin-right:4px;"></span>' "increases&nbsp;&nbsp;" '<span style="display:inline-block;width:10px;height:10px;' 'border-radius:2px;background:#1E88E5;margin-right:4px;"></span>' "decreases</div>" f'<div style="font-size:15px;word-break:break-word;">{body}</div>' "</div>" "<style>" ".nlp-shap-token{display:inline-block;padding:3px 7px;margin:2px 3px 2px 0;" "border-radius:4px;transition:box-shadow .15s ease;}" ".nlp-shap-token:hover{box-shadow:0 0 0 1px rgba(17,24,39,.12);}" "</style>" )
def _draw_color_legend(axis: Any) -> None: axis.text( 0.02, 0.08, "● increases", transform=axis.transAxes, fontsize=9, color="#FF0D57", ha="left", va="center", ) axis.text( 0.16, 0.08, "● decreases", transform=axis.transAxes, fontsize=9, color="#1E88E5", ha="left", va="center", ) def _escape_html(text: str) -> str: return ( text .replace("&", "&amp;") .replace("<", "&lt;") .replace(">", "&gt;") .replace('"', "&quot;") )
